    Louisville lost 6-4. Hopper and Watson went 2-4. Kata had a HR (9). Salmon pitched 2 innings, 0 hits, 1 walk, 2 Ks. Will he ever get a chance?

    Chattanooga is down 6-3 in the 8th. Bannon is 2-4. Dickerson has a HR (6). Vazquez gave up 6 runs in 5.1 innings, walked 2, K'd 2, and gave up 2 HRs.

    Sarasota lost 5-1. Garthwaite and Lawhorn (I thought he got released) went 2-4. Avery went 5 innings, 6 hits, 0 runs, 2 Ks, 2 walks.

    Dayton is up 8-1 in the 8th. Here are the hitters:

    DeJesus 3-5
    Griffin 3-4 2 HR (6) 3 RBI (43) 3 R
    Szymanski 2-5 HR (14) 3 RBI (53)
    Hernandez 5-5 5 singles

    Rafael Gonzalez went 5.1 innings, 1 hit, 2 walks, 3 Ks
    Lutz went 2 innings, 1 hit, 1 unearned run, 0 walks, 3 Ks

    Billings is off tonight.

    VSL Reds lost 9-2.

    GCL box is posted above.
